What is the Uncontested Motion to Continue?
The Uncontested Motion to Continue is a specific legal form utilized in Louisiana courts to request a delay in proceedings such as hearings or trials. Its main purpose is to provide a clear and formal request for a continuance. This motion serves an important function within the legal system, allowing parties to protect their rights and ensure adequate preparation time.
The form includes key components such as the scheduled date of the hearing, the requested continuance date, and the rationale for the request. Understanding the nuances of this uncontested motion is essential for effective legal practice in Louisiana.

Eligibility Criteria for the Uncontested Motion to Continue
To file the Uncontested Motion to Continue, certain eligibility criteria must be met. The parties that qualify typically include the Attorney for Mover or a Self-Represented Party. The conditions that justify a continuance often involve valid reasons such as illness, scheduling issues, or insufficient preparation time.
Furthermore, it is crucial for the form to have the proper signatures from the relevant parties as mandated by Louisiana law, specifically LA CCP Art 1602.

Who can file the Uncontested Motion to Continue?
Either an attorney representing the mover or a self-represented party in Louisiana can file the Uncontested Motion to Continue.
Is there a deadline for submitting this motion?
The motion should be submitted as soon as it is determined that a continuance is necessary, ideally before the scheduled hearing date to ensure appropriate processing.
